Popular Boho Bathroom Paint Colors
When it comes to selecting paint colors for a bohemian bathroom, there are a few standout options that can help evoke the desired ambiance. Earthy tones, jewel tones, and pastel shades all play a significant role in creating a boho vibe. Each of these color families can be utilized to craft different moods and atmospheres. Earthy tones like terracotta, sage green, and soft browns connect the space to nature, promoting a sense of calmness. Jewel tones, such as deep blues, rich purples, and vibrant greens, add depth and luxury, creating a lavish oasis. Lastly, pastel shades like soft pinks, light blues, and mint greens can lighten the room, making it feel airy and inviting. Mixing and matching these colors allows for an expressive and unique design that resonates with the bohemian spirit.
Earthy Tones
Earthy tones are a staple in bohemian bathrooms, often seen in shades like terracotta, sage green, and soft browns. These colors draw inspiration from the natural world, promoting a serene and grounding environment. Earthy tones can be used on all four walls or as an accent against lighter tiles and fixtures, fostering a warm and inviting atmosphere that connects with the outdoors.
Jewel Tones
For those looking to make a statement, jewel tones are an excellent choice. Colors like deep blues, rich purples, and vibrant greens can instantly add depth and luxury to your bathroom space. Jewel tones can be particularly effective when used as accents on a feature wall or through decorative elements such as towels and artwork, enhancing the overall aesthetic without overwhelming the senses.
Pastel Shades
Pastel colors offer a softer approach to bohemian design, perfect for creating a light and airy vibe. Shades like soft pinks, light blues, and mint greens evoke a sense of freshness and tranquility. Pastel shades work beautifully in smaller bathrooms, making the space feel larger and brighter. They can be combined with natural wood accents and plants to enhance the bohemian aesthetic, allowing for a playful yet harmonious design.
Trends in Bohemian Bathroom Colors
As with any design style, trends in bohemian bathroom colors continue to evolve. Current trends include the use of accent walls, color blocking, and the combination of various shades to create depth and interest. An accent wall painted in a bold jewel tone can serve as a focal point, while the surrounding walls in softer pastel shades balance the overall look. Color blocking, where two or more contrasting colors are used in the same space, is another popular technique that adds a modern twist to the bohemian style. By incorporating these trends, homeowners can enhance the visual appeal of their bathrooms while still embracing the core principles of bohemian design.
